Florence: The Wire Haired Dachshund Gone Too Soon

When Val got in touch with me, she wanted to create something truly special for her granddaughter Seren. Seren’s beloved wire dachshund, Florence, had sadly been killed in a tragic accident, and the whole family was heartbroken. Florence had been such a huge part of Seren’s life, and Val wanted her to have something she could wear every day to keep Florence close to her heart.

Florence was clearly a very special little dog, loved deeply not only by Seren but by everyone who knew her. Creating memorial jewellery is always emotional, but pieces like this feel especially meaningful because they hold so many memories and so much love within them.

Using Val’s photographs as inspiration, I made Florence as a necklace in silver, oxidised silver and rose gold. One of the things I loved most about Florence was the way she sat in the photographs, so I recreated her in exactly the same position.

I carefully captured her long ears, bright eyes, little nose and tail, adding layers of oxidised silver and warm rose gold tones so the piece would catch the light beautifully from every angle.
